AntV数据可视化如何支持数据可视化交互?

在当今大数据时代,数据可视化已经成为数据分析的重要手段。AntV作为国内领先的数据可视化解决方案,其强大的功能和易用性受到了众多开发者的青睐。本文将深入探讨AntV数据可视化如何支持数据可视化交互,帮助开发者更好地实现数据可视化项目。

一、AntV数据可视化简介

AntV是一款基于React、Vue和Node.js的数据可视化解决方案,旨在帮助开发者轻松实现各种数据可视化需求。AntV提供了丰富的图表类型,包括但不限于柱状图、折线图、饼图、地图等,同时支持自定义图表样式和交互效果。

二、AntV数据可视化交互支持

  1. 丰富的交互组件

AntV提供了丰富的交互组件,如筛选器缩放拖拽旋转等,开发者可以根据实际需求选择合适的组件,实现数据可视化交互。


  1. 事件监听与响应

AntV支持事件监听与响应,开发者可以通过监听图表事件,如点击、拖拽等,实现与用户的交互。例如,当用户点击图表中的某个数据点时,可以弹出详细信息框,或者跳转到相应的页面。


  1. 动态数据更新

AntV支持动态数据更新,开发者可以实时更新图表数据,实现与用户的实时交互。例如,在股票交易分析中,可以实时更新股票价格,帮助用户了解市场动态。


  1. 组件联动

AntV支持组件联动,开发者可以将多个图表进行联动,实现数据交互。例如,在分析销售数据时,可以将销售额、销售区域、销售产品等图表进行联动,方便用户从不同维度分析数据。


  1. 自定义交互效果

AntV支持自定义交互效果,开发者可以根据实际需求,通过编写代码实现独特的交互效果。例如,可以自定义点击效果、悬停效果等,提升用户体验。

三、案例分析

  1. 电商数据分析

某电商企业使用AntV数据可视化对销售数据进行分析。通过AntV提供的筛选器组件,用户可以筛选特定时间段、特定产品类别的销售数据。同时,通过组件联动,用户可以查看不同产品类别的销售情况,从而为产品优化和营销策略提供数据支持。


  1. 舆情分析

某舆情分析平台使用AntV数据可视化展示网络舆情。通过AntV提供的地图组件,用户可以查看不同地区的舆情分布。同时,通过筛选器组件,用户可以筛选特定时间段、特定关键词的舆情数据,从而了解舆情发展趋势。

四、总结

AntV数据可视化在交互支持方面具有强大的功能,能够满足开发者对数据可视化交互的各种需求。通过AntV,开发者可以轻松实现丰富的数据可视化项目,提升用户体验。在未来的发展中,AntV将继续优化产品,为开发者提供更优质的数据可视化解决方案。

猜你喜欢:云原生NPM